How to fix car photos

  1. 1

    Upload your photo

    Choose a clear, straight-on photo of your car that shows the damage you want to fix.

  2. 2

    Describe the edits

    In the prompt box, type exactly what you want: e.g. "remove the dent on the fender" or "smooth out scratches on the hood."

  3. 3

    Generate the edit

    Click the Generate button. Pixelcut’s AI will process your instructions and apply the repair or damage to the image.

  4. 4

    Download the result

    Once the image is generated, click download to save the high-resolution, watermark-free PNG of the repaired car photo.
